Who We Are?
SLTF provides quality legal assistance, consultancy, and training designed to promote peace, economic growth, and sustainable political development.
1. Strategic Advisory & Legal Coordination
We act as a trusted legal coordinator for reform-minded governments, public bodies, the judiciary, policymakers, and key stakeholders, offering expert guidance on:
-
Constitutional Reform: Guiding and supporting the constitutional review process.
-
Human Rights & Minority Protection: Advocating for the protection of minorities and assisting victims of war.
-
Humanitarian & Legal Affairs: Coordinating responses to complex humanitarian and legal challenges.
2. Conflict Resolution & Economic Growth
We deliver specialized consultancy and legal assistance aimed at resolving conflict and fostering long-term economic and social development across the region.
3. Empowering the Next Generation of Lawyers
We are deeply committed to training, mentoring, and empowering young lawyers and legal scholars. By expanding their capacities and skillsets, we help build the legal leadership needed to sustain democracy, political integrity, and rule of law.

OUR SERVICES
Delivering high-level legal consultancy, policy coordination, and capacity building to promote peace, human rights, and political reform in Sudan.
At the Sudanese Lawyers Task Force (SLTF), we combine global legal expertise with local insights to offer specialized advisory services, professional education, and advocacy programs. We work alongside governments, public institutions, civil society, and legal professionals to build a just and sustainable future.
1. Strategic Advisory & Legal Coordination
SLTF serves as an expert legal coordinator for reform-minded governments, public bodies, judicial institutions, policymakers, and international stakeholders.
-
Constitutional Review Support: Providing technical legal consultancy, drafting assistance, and advisory frameworks during national and regional constitutional review processes.
-
Judicial & Public Sector Reform: Assisting public bodies and the judiciary in modernizing legal structures, enhancing institutional transparency, and strengthening the rule of law.
-
Policy Guidance: Advisory services on regulatory frameworks, governance, and policy alignment with international standards.
2. Human Rights, Minority Protection & War Victims Support
We provide direct advocacy and legal frameworks to safeguard vulnerable populations and individuals affected by armed conflict.
-
Legal Assistance for War Victims: Assisting displaced persons and war victims with legal documentation, property claims, and navigating pathways to international protection.
-
Rights Awareness & Community Outreach: Conducting legal literacy programs and delivering accessible guides to inform communities of their fundamental human rights.
-
Pro Bono Legal Network: Mobilizing our network of legal practitioners to offer free legal consultation and representation for marginalized and minority groups.
3. Conflict Resolution & Development Consulting
SLTF designs legal strategies that support peacebuilding, stability, and sustainable growth across the region.
-
Conflict Resolution Frameworks: Offering expert consultancy on dispute resolution, mediation, and reconciliation processes tailored to post-conflict settings.
-
Socio-Economic Development Consulting: Advising on legal structures that foster economic development, attract investment, and protect social welfare.
-
Stakeholder Bridge-Building: Facilitating direct communication between Sudanese civil society, international organizations, and government entities to align reform efforts.
4. Professional Development & Capacity Building
We are dedicated to building a skilled, trauma-informed, and forward-thinking legal community.
-
Continuing Professional Development (CPD): Conducting expert-led seminars, workshops, and CPD courses on specialized topics, including International Humanitarian Law (IHL), refugee rights, and commercial law.
-
Next-Gen Legal Mentorship: Tailored training programs and mentorship initiatives for law students and early-career lawyers to prepare the next generation of legal leaders.
-
Academic & Practical Research: Hosting legal forums and publishing research to inform legal practice and ongoing policy reform.
5. International Liaison & Delegation Services
SLTF acts as a primary bridge connecting Sudanese legal professionals with international civil society and global networks.
-
International Delegate Support: Issuing complimentary official invitation letters to facilitate travel and international participation for overseas delegates attending conferences, seminars, and summits.
-
Global Network Access: Connecting local practitioners with international human rights organizations, academic institutions, and global legal networks.
